Solving Chronic Gutter Overflow at Monadnock Indoor Tennis Club
How an undersized gutter system was causing overflow, fascia damage, and interior leaks, and what we installed to fix it for good.
Monadnock Indoor Tennis Club, Peterborough, NH — completed December 2024
Large buildings often reveal gutter problems that are easy to miss until water starts getting inside.
At the Monadnock Indoor Tennis Club in Peterborough, New Hampshire, the existing gutter system was struggling to handle the amount of water coming off the building's large flat roof. The symptoms were clear:
- Overflowing gutters during heavy rain
- Water getting behind the gutter system
- Damaged fascia boards
- Interior leaks
- Basement water issues
- Sagging gutter sections
The solution wasn't simply replacing old gutters with new ones the same size. The building needed a drainage system designed around the size of the roof, the length of the gutter runs, and the weather conditions common in New Hampshire. In December 2024, we completed a full commercial gutter upgrade built to correct the drainage problems and hold up for the long term.

The Problem: An Undersized Commercial Gutter System
The original gutter system was undersized for the demands of the building. The facility had long gutter runs but only small 5-inch gutters and four 2x3 downspouts located at the corners. For a residential home, that setup can work fine in a lot of situations. For a large commercial building with a flat roof, it created a drainage bottleneck.
Commercial Gutter Inspection Findings in Peterborough, NH
When we inspected the building, several issues pointed to the same underlying problem: the gutter system wasn't designed for the amount of water the roof actually produced.
Undersized Gutters
The building had 5-inch gutters installed along large sections of the roof. Sizing a gutter system correctly takes more than matching it to the building footprint — roof size, roof pitch, drainage paths, rainfall intensity, and outlet locations all factor in. This building had a large flat roof collecting significant runoff, and the existing gutters simply didn't have enough capacity during heavy storms.
Too Few Downspouts
One of the biggest problems was the downspout layout. The long gutter runs were sending large amounts of water toward the corners, where only small 2x3 downspouts were available to remove it. Water can only leave the gutter as fast as the outlets allow it to. When too much water is forced through too few downspouts, the gutter itself becomes the bottleneck — and the result is overflow, especially during intense rain or fast snowmelt.
Sagging Gutters and Poor Support
The existing gutters were also sagging in areas. A gutter that isn't properly supported can develop low spots where water collects instead of flowing toward the downspouts. As water sits in those spots, the added weight puts more stress on the system, creating a cycle of sagging and overflow. For a commercial building in New Hampshire, proper support matters even more, since gutters have to handle rainwater plus snow and ice loads.
Water Behind the Gutter
Another concern was water getting behind the gutter system. When water doesn't enter the gutter properly, it can run behind it and soak into the fascia boards. Over time, that leads to rotten fascia, wood damage, interior leaks, and higher maintenance costs. A gutter system needs to work together with the roof edge and drip edge to direct water where it belongs.
Why the Original Gutter System Failed
A large flat roof creates a different drainage challenge than a typical home. Water concentrates into long runs and needs enough capacity and enough outlets to move away from the building efficiently. The original design had three main limitations:
- The gutter size was too small for the roof's demands
- The downspouts were too small and too limited in number
- The long gutter runs let too much water collect before reaching an outlet
The building needed a complete drainage solution, not just a replacement gutter.

Our Solution: Designing a Commercial Gutter System That Works
6-Inch Seamless Aluminum Gutters
We replaced the undersized system with 6-inch K-style seamless aluminum gutters. The larger profile gives the system more capacity for heavy rain events, so it can handle more water before reaching overflow conditions. Moving from a residential-style setup to a properly sized commercial application was one of the most important changes on this job.
Heavy-Duty .032 Aluminum Construction
We used .032 aluminum rather than a lighter gauge, because these gutters had long runs and needed to hold up to the demands of a commercial building in New Hampshire. During a heavy storm, gutters can hold a significant amount of water weight; in winter, snow and ice add even more stress. The heavier aluminum gives a stronger, more stable system for longer sections and tougher conditions.
Larger 3x4 Downspouts
The original system relied on 2x3 downspouts. We upgraded to heavy-duty 3x4 downspouts, which let water leave the gutter faster and reduce the bottleneck that was causing overflow. They also give a stronger connection point for a larger commercial gutter system.
Additional Downspouts Along Long Runs
Bigger outlets alone weren't the whole fix — the building also needed more places for water to exit. We added downspouts along the long gutter runs to shorten the distance water had to travel, which reduces water depth in the gutter, cuts stress on the system, improves drainage during heavy storms, and lowers overflow risk.
Custom Gooseneck Downspout Offsets
Some areas needed custom solutions because of existing building conditions. We fabricated custom gooseneck offsets where needed to keep drainage working properly around those obstacles. Small details like this keep water moving instead of creating new restrictions.
Strengthening the Installation
Closer Hanger Spacing
We installed hangers about 16 inches apart. A lot of gutter installations use wider spacing, but commercial buildings and New Hampshire winters call for extra support. Closer spacing helps the gutters handle the combined weight of rainwater, snow, and ice.
Fascia Repairs
Damaged fascia boards were removed and replaced in problem areas, including the front entrance, which gave the new gutters a solid mounting surface and helped restore the look of the building.
Drip Edge Improvements
We adjusted the drip edge to improve water entry into the gutters and reduce the chance of water getting behind the system. Proper drainage depends on the roof edge, gutter, and drainage system all working together.
Snow Guards
Clear snow guards were installed on both sides of the building. Flat roofs in New Hampshire need extra planning, since snow can release suddenly and put stress on gutters and anything below.

The Results: A Properly Sized Commercial Gutter System
The completed system addressed the original drainage problems. The Monadnock Indoor Tennis Club now has more gutter capacity, better water flow, more efficient drainage, stronger support, and better protection against fascia and foundation damage. The system was designed specifically for this building, not a one-size-fits-all replacement.
Six Months Later: How the System Performed Through Winter
A gutter system shouldn't only look good on installation day — the real test comes after it's been through New Hampshire weather. This project was completed in December 2024, right before winter conditions arrived.
After a major winter storm, we returned to the property to help clear snow from the flat roof. Even with a properly designed gutter system, flat commercial roofs still need snow management when loads get heavy. While we were there, we inspected the gutter installation. It held up as expected — the gutters stayed secure, the added support points were performing properly, and the drainage improvements were working as designed.
That follow-up visit matters to us. Finishing the installation is only part of the job. Watching the system perform through a real New Hampshire winter is what confirms the design choices were right.
What Other Commercial Property Owners Can Learn
A gutter system isn't just a metal channel bolted to the edge of a roof — it's a drainage system, and the right design depends on roof size, roof shape, gutter length, downspout placement, material strength, and local weather conditions. When a large building has drainage problems, replacing the gutters with the same size system rarely solves it. The better question to ask is: why did the original system fail? Once you know the answer, the right solution gets a lot clearer.
